Looking for a fresh start in a new home this year? Check out 14 Fields Avenue in Brockton! This beautiful 1,246 Sq Ft rental offers 3 spacious bedrooms, 1 bathroom, and a convenient laundry room with brand-new washer and dryer. With ample hallway closets for extra storage, this home has it all.

Stay comfortable year-round with central heating and air conditioning throughout. The owner has thoughtfully designed this new build with modern touches, including stainless steel appliances (oven, microwave, refrigerator, dishwasher) and sleek hardwood floors throughout.

Want to enjoy some outdoor space? This home features a private deck perfect for summer entertaining, plus private driveway parking for your convenience.

Located on the Westside of Brockton, you're just a 5-10-minute drive from Westgate Mall, a variety of restaurants, schools, shopping centers (including Market Basket, Marshalls, Lowe's), gyms, and I-93.
